На информационном ресурсе применяются cookie-файлы. Оставаясь на сайте, вы подтверждаете свое согласие на их использование.
Можно ли подключить локальную БД через TCP IP?
3090
8
Simple minds
activist
Есть ли пути решения такой задачи:
Есть данные компании. Часть из них хранится в MySQL на интернет-сервере компании, а часть требуется хранить в локальной MS Access. Ряд отчетов требует объединения этих данных. Как бы их связать?
Предвидя "сюрпризы" все таблицы и поля в Access имеют нормальные латинские названия. На локальной машине все работает через ODBC прекрасно. А вот можно ли зная текущий IP подключиться извне? КТо-нибудь реально делал такое дабы не изобретать велосипед? Или где почитать?
Есть данные компании. Часть из них хранится в MySQL на интернет-сервере компании, а часть требуется хранить в локальной MS Access. Ряд отчетов требует объединения этих данных. Как бы их связать?
Предвидя "сюрпризы" все таблицы и поля в Access имеют нормальные латинские названия. На локальной машине все работает через ODBC прекрасно. А вот можно ли зная текущий IP подключиться извне? КТо-нибудь реально делал такое дабы не изобретать велосипед? Или где почитать?
craxx
рыжий котэ
Да без проблем.
Тока тебе твой комп с Акцессовской базой придется расшарить для полного доступа извне.
что не есть хорошо!
Тока тебе твой комп с Акцессовской базой придется расшарить для полного доступа извне.
что не есть хорошо!
Simple minds
activist
Да без проблем.Да уж... Иных вариантов, как я понимаю, нет. Вопрос снимаем. Пойдем огорчать начальство
Тока тебе твой комп с Акцессовской базой придется расшарить для полного доступа извне.
что не есть хорошо!

Да без проблем.Полный доступ извне совсем не обязателен. Фаейрволом можно закрыть все, кроме портов к Access. Помимо того, если заранее известны адреса (диапазон адресов), то можно ограничить подключение извне только ими.
Тока тебе твой комп с Акцессовской базой придется расшарить для полного доступа извне.
что не есть хорошо!
DeHuC
v.i.p.
а не проще в акцессе скрипт синхронизации написать и валить все в централизованную базу?
Simple minds
activist
а не проще в акцессе скрипт синхронизации написать и валить все в централизованную базу?По условиям задачи нельзя. Т.е. нельзя часть данных ни как передавать на сервер - это закрытые данные по клиентам и естественно директор справедливо не согласен их хранить в сети в любом виде. Условие одно - эти данные на съемом носителе (типа USBdrive) на цепочке у сердца
И подключаются только при обработке заказов.Ну в общем то задача решена даже пока без Access. Дальше посмотрим что лучше пойдет.
DeHuC
v.i.p.
задача какая то неправильная. если информация закрытая, то надо расставлять соответсвующие разрешения на таблицы и использовать выделенные каналы для связи с БД, а все остальное колхоз 

Сейчас читают
Как избавиться от комплекса по поводу маленькой груди
179075
668
Кофейня (часть 10)
176490
1000
Любимая, дай пожалуйста мне денег!
33071
168
Да уж ... Шеф с usb драйвом на цепочке как связующий элемент в dataflow моделе - это готично 

Илья
xxx
Есть ли пути решения такой задачи:попробуй использовать репликацию
Есть данные компании. Часть из них хранится в MySQL на интернет-сервере компании, а часть требуется хранить в локальной MS Access. Ряд отчетов требует объединения этих данных. Как бы их связать?
Предвидя "сюрпризы" все таблицы и поля в Access имеют нормальные латинские названия. На локальной машине все работает через ODBC прекрасно. А вот можно ли зная текущий IP подключиться извне? КТо-нибудь реально делал такое дабы не изобретать велосипед? Или где почитать?